Order
84540-47-6
2,6-Dihydroxy-3,4-dimethylpyridine
Order
111-71-7
Heptaldehyde
Order
10032-05-1
Such-and-such aldehyde two methanol acetals
Order
84041-77-0
Bis-1,4-(2-hydroxyethylamino)-2-nitrobenzene
Order
66-25-1
Caproaldehyde
Order
6728-26-3
TRANS-2-HEXENAL
Order
149330-25-6
Bis-2,6-N,N-(2-hydroxyethyl)diaminotoluene
Order
928-95-0
trans-2-Hexen-1-ol
Order
93841-25-9
2-(2-Hydroxy)ethyl-p-phenylene diamino sulfate
Order
141-92-4
8,8-Dimethoxy-2,6-dimethyloctan-2-ol
Order
624-18-0
p-Phenylenediamine dihydrochloride
Order
112-54-9
Dodecyl aldehyde
Order
106-73-0
Methyl heptanoate
Order
54381-16-7
N,N-Bis(2-hydroxyethyl)-p-phenylenediamine sulphate
Order
124-19-6
1-Nonanal
Order
124-13-0
Octanal
Order
10022-28-3
1,1-Dimethoxyoctane
Order
123-38-6
Propionaldehyde
Order
7774-65-6
2 - [b] thiophene mercaptan
Order
112-44-7
UNDECANAL
Contact Us